Energy-efficient

Double glazing can reduce your energy costs by helping to keep heat in and cold out. They can also create an environment that is more peaceful and boost the value of your home. If you're looking to make your home to be as eco sustainable as you can, think about upgrading to double-glazed windows with Low-E glass. This kind of glass comes with special coating that can help reflect sunlight, which reduces heat transfer and improves the comfort of your home.

You can choose from a wide variety of styles for your new double-glazed windows. uPVC is the most well-known choice. This material is cost-effective and can be colored to match your decor and has a lengthy lifespan. You can also opt for timber frames or aluminium. Both offer a modern look but don't provide the same thermal efficiency as uPVC.

Stronger glass

Modern double-glazed windows are a lot thicker than single-pane windows from the past and have an insulating space between them. This helps reduce heat loss and boosts efficiency in energy use. It also acts as a solid barrier against noise pollution. Depending on the window type, it may have low-emissivity gas or argon to increase insulation. It also has a toughened safety glass. The windows come in a variety of styles and finishes to suit your home.

Reduces UV Rays

Double glazing is a type of window with two glass panes which are placed in a frame to create an insulating space between the windows. They are designed to block heat from leaving the home and also provide protection against colder weather and noise. They can be used to replace a single-paned windows in new homes, or for existing windows. They are also often called insulated glass units (IGUs).

The space between the two panes of double glazed near me-glazed windows is typically filled with a gas which is inert, such as the argon or krypton. This gas adds an extra layer of insulation and boosts the R-value of the window. The space between the panes can also be tinted, or annealed to enhance thermal performance.

Another benefit of double-glazed windows is that they cut down on the amount of UV rays entering your home. This is crucial as UV rays are known to harm furniture and fabrics. Double glazing can prevent condensation that could create a musty odor and encourage the growth mildew spores which can erode woodwork or upholstery.
